FAQs

How can I choose the best stopper guard for my needs?

Consider the size, material, and intended use of the stopper guard. Ensure it fits securely and is suitable for the surface it will be applied to.

What are the key features to look for when selecting products in the stopper guard category?

Look for features such as durability, ease of installation, and the ability to withstand weight or pressure without slipping.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ing stopper guards?

One common mistake is not measuring the space correctly, which can lead to purchasing the wrong size or type of stopper guard.

Can stopper guards be used on all types of surfaces?

Most stopper guards are designed for various surfaces, but it's essential to check the manufacturer's recommendations for compatibility.

How do I install a stopper guard?

Installation typically involves cleaning the surface, peeling off the adhesive backing (if applicable), and firmly pressing the stopper guard into place.
